Colon Schools have two candidates

Colon Community Schools officials have whittled their list of top administrative candidates from three to two.

Victor Bungi and Mike Corey made the final cut following a day-long session of meetings Tuesday with committees and the district’s board of education. Candidate Drew Bordner was eliminated Tuesday.

Bungi, of Gladstone, is curriculum and instruction supervisor for the Delta/Schoolcraft Intermediate School District in the Upper Peninsula.

Corey, of Mesick, is superintendent of Mesick Public Schools.

Board president Ernie Baker said a site visit between now and the board’s April 21 regularly scheduled meeting will be the next course of action. He said Bungi previously held an administrative position at a Traverse City-area district. Rather than venture to the Upper Peninsula, district officials who make the site visit will instead find out more about Bungi from his former employer in Traverse City.

They plan to spend a day in Mesick on the way up to gain more feedback about Corey.

Either way, Baker said he is confident a decision will be made April 21.
